92 providers in Diabetic Kidney Disease, Ophthalmology, Orthopedic Surgery, Pediatric Cardiovascular Surgery

92 providers in Diabetic Kidney Disease, Ophthalmology, Orthopedic Surgery, Pediatric Cardiovascular Surgery